By 10 weeks of pregnancy, your baby has eyelids, though they are fused shut for now (Hill 2020a, Moore et al 2019a, Tawfik et al 2016).This helps to protect your baby's developing eyes, until they're ready to open at around 27 weeks (Hill 2020a, Moore et al 2019a, Tawfik et al 2016).Once his eyes are open, he'll be able to blink in response to bright light (Moore et al 2019a).
